-
_tl;dr: This issue proposes introducing a syntax to call `@rule`s by name, and deprecating the `Get`-by-return-type syntax in almost all cases (`@union`s TBD)._
# Motivation
Currently, rather th…
-
Prover produces an internal error about duplicated boogie procedures. Perhaps, this may be related to the monomorphization step, although it needs a further investigation.
# How to reproduce
In …
-
### What version of Go are you using (`go version`)?
$ go version
go version devel +893c5ec17b Thu Jul 16 21:30:46 2020 +0000 windows/amd64
### Does this issue reproduce with the latest rel…
-
Right now, the `fj` crate doesn't use a math library, instead just using arrays to represent points and vectors. This works well enough for simple models, but might become inconvenient for more comple…
-
For monomorphization and erasure of Boolean formulas it might be useful to annotate types or type variables. For example:
```
def map[a: Type, b: Type, ef: Bool @ Erased](f: a -> b & ef)
```
o…
-
This path normalization utility lives in `artichoke-backend`.
https://github.com/artichoke/artichoke/blob/2fe83803834963deef45e5fa8a295188902b72b7/artichoke-backend/src/load_path.rs#L66-L246
Mov…
-
Currently, our actors are pretty large (over 2MiB in some cases). Unfortunately, we _really_ want to keep a 2MiB upper limit on IPLD objects. If we don't fix this _now_, this will be a pain for us _la…
-
Use Golang 1.18 (as minimal requirement) for Gitea 1.17 release, make sure the Golang version is still actively supported during Gitea 1.17 lifecycle.
And Gitea can start using Golang generics from…
-
It has been a long-standing limitation that only one `#[methods]` blocks can be exposed for any given type. There are many reasons why it's desirable to remove this limitation:
- Generally, Rust pu…
-
`icu_capi` cannot handle `BakedDataProvider` directly. Is there a way to handle it without modifying `icu_capi`?
Of course, we can handle it if we modify `icu_capi` like the following.
```rust
#[…